Cancun, Mexico — A cyclist died Friday night after being struck by a pickup truck in Cancun, with the driver fleeing the scene, authorities reported.
The crash occurred around 9 p.m. on Andrés Quintana Roo Avenue near Kinik Avenue, close to Plaza Outlet.
According to initial reports, the man, whose identity has not been released, was traveling north when the pickup truck hit him, throwing him onto the pavement.
Witnesses reported the incident, prompting a response from Municipal Traffic Police, Municipal Police, and paramedics. Upon arrival, paramedics confirmed the cyclist had died.
After the crash, the driver fled the area. Police officers launched a search operation but did not locate the suspect.
Forensic experts from the State Prosecutor’s Office later transported the body to the Medical Examiner’s Office and collected evidence to determine the circumstances of the incident.
